Global Packaged Sprouts Market size was valued at USD 4.05 Billion in 2023 and is poised to grow from USD 4.52 Billion in 2024 to USD 9.90 Billion by 2032, growing at a CAGR of 10.30% during the forecast period (2025-2032).
Global Packaged Sprouts indicate a strong demand driven by rising health consciousness and a shift towards convenient, ready-to-eat options. The growing popularity of plant-based diets is further enhancing market momentum, alongside an increased preference for nutritious, low-calorie, and organic products. Key trends include the ascent of clean-label offerings, a commitment to sustainable farming practices, and a surge in veganism. Companies are innovating with packaging solutions that enhance freshness and shelf-life, while expanding retail channels-including supermarkets and online grocery platforms-broaden market reach. However, the industry faces challenges such as short product shelf life, contamination risks, stringent regulations, fluctuating raw material costs, and varying consumer awareness, which could impact growth prospects in certain regions.

Global Packaged Sprouts Market Segments Analysis
The global packaged sprouts market is segmented by type, category, distribution channel, and region. Based on type, the market is segmented into bean sprouts, brussels sprouts, broccoli sprouts, alfalfa sprouts, and soybean sprouts. Based on category, the market is segmented into organic and conventional. Based on distribution channels, the market is segmented into supermarkets, convenience stores, specialty stores, and online retail. Based on region, the market is segmented into North America, Europe, Asia Pacific, Latin America, and the Middle East and Africa.

Restraints in the Global Packaged Sprouts Market
One significant constraint in the Global Packaged Sprouts market is the highly perishable quality of the product. Sprouts necessitate stringent temperature control and cleanliness to maintain their safety and freshness, making them vulnerable to contamination and spoilage. This susceptibility limits their shelf life and often restricts distribution to localized areas. Consequently, suppliers and retailers face challenges such as increased product waste, potential recalls, and diminished profitability. The introduction of packaged sprouts into the market is thus hindered by these factors, compelling stakeholders to navigate issues associated with quality control and inventory management to sustain their operations.
